Abstract
OBJECTIVE Hepatitis C is an important risk factor for cirrhosis and liver cancer in the Taiwanese population. Domestic prisons reported a higher rate of hepatitis C infection than the national average. Efficient and effective treatment of patients with hepatitis C in prisons is required to decrease the number of infections. This study analysed the effectiveness of hepatitis C treatment and its side effects in prison patients. DESIGN This retrospective analysis included adult patients with hepatitis C who received direct-acting antiviral agents between 2018 and 2021. SETTING The special hepatitis C clinics in the two prisons were run by a medium-sized hepatitis C treatment hospital in Southern Taiwan. Three direct-acting antiviral agents, sofosbuvir/ledipasvir for 12 weeks, glecaprevir/pibrentasvir for 8 or 12 weeks and sofosbuvir/velpatasvir for 12 weeks, were adopted based on patient characteristics. PARTICIPANTS 470 patients were included. OUTCOME MEASURE The sustained virological response at 12 weeks after the end of treatment was compared between the different groups. RESULTS Most of the patients were men (70.0%) with a median age of 44 years. The most prevalent hepatitis C virus genotype was genotype 1 (44.26%). A total of 240 patients (51.06%) had a history of injectable drug use; 44 (9.36%) and 71 (15.11%) patients were coinfected with hepatitis B virus and HIV, respectively. Only 51 patients (10.85%) had liver cirrhosis. Most patients (98.30%) had normal renal function or no history of kidney disease. The patients had a sustained virological response achievement rate of 99.2%. The average incidence of adverse reactions during treatment was approximately 10%. Many of the adverse reactions were mild and resolved spontaneously. CONCLUSION Direct-acting antiviral agents are effective for treating hepatitis C in Taiwanese prisoners. These therapeutics were well-tolerated by the patient population.

Abstract
Hepatitis C virus (HCV) infection is common among injection drug users (IDUs). There is accumulating evidence that circulating microRNAs (miRNAs) are associated with HCV infection and disease progression. The present study was undertaken to determine the in vivo impact of heroin use on HCV infection and HCV-related circulating miRNA expression. Using the blood specimens from four groups of the study subjects (HCV-infected individuals, heroin users with/without HCV infection, and healthy volunteers), we found that HCV-infected heroin users had significantly higher viral load than HCV-infected non-heroin users (p = 0.0004). Measurement of HCV-related circulating miRNAs in plasma showed that miRs-122, 141, 29a, 29b, and 29c were significantly increased in the heroin users with HCV infection, whereas miR-351, an HCV inhibitory miRNA, was significantly decreased in heroin users as compared to control subjects. Further investigation identified a negative correlation between the plasma levels of miR-29 family members and severity of HCV infection based on aspartate aminotransferase to platelet ratio index (APRI). In addition, heroin use and/or HCV infection also dysregulated a panel of plasma miRNAs. Taken together, these data for the first time revealed in vivo evidence that heroin use and/or HCV infection alter circulating miRNAs, which provides a novel mechanism for the impaired innate anti-HCV immunity among IDUs.

Abstract
The aim of this study is to explore the prevalence of hepatitis C virus (HCV) infection among injection drug users (IDUs) with and without human immunodeficiency virus (HIV) infection in southern Taiwan. For 562 IDUs (265 anti-HIV negative, 297 anti-HIV positive), we analyzed liver function, anti-HIV antibody, anti-HCV antibody, HCV viral loads, and hepatitis B surface antigen (HBsAg). HIV RNA viral loads and CD4 cell count for anti-HIV-seropositive IDUs and the HCV genotype for HCV RNA-seropositive IDUs were measured. The seroprevalence rates of anti-HIV, anti-HCV, and HBsAg were 52.8%, 91.3%, and 15.3%, respectively. All the anti-HIV-seropositive IDUs were positive for HIV RNA. Anti-HCV seropositivity was the most important factor associated with HIV infection (odds ratio [OR], 25.06; 95% confidence intervals [CI], 8.97-74.9), followed by male gender (OR, 6.12; 95% CI, 4.05-9.39) and HBsAg seropositivity (OR, 1.90; 95% CI, 1.11-3.34). Among IDUs positive for anti-HCV, 80.7% had detectable HCV RNA. HCV viremia after HCV exposure was strongly related to HIV infection (OR, 6.262; 95% CI, 1.515-18.28), but negatively correlated to HBsAg seropositivity (OR, 0.161; 95% CI, 0.082-0.317). HCV genotype 6 was the most prevalent genotype among all IDUs (41.0%), followed by genotypes 1 (32.3%), 3 (12.8%), and 2 (5.6%). In conclusion, about half IDUs were infected with HIV and >90% with HCV infection. Male and seropositivity for HBsAg and anti-HCV were factors related to HIV infection among our IDUs. HIV was positively correlated, whereas hepatitis B co-infection was negatively correlated with HCV viremia among IDUs with HCV exposure. Different HCV molecular epidemiology was noted among IDUs.

Abstract
BACKGROUND Injecting drug users (IDUs) in Taiwan contributed significantly to an HIV/AIDS epidemic in 2005. In addition, studies that identified risk factors of HCV/HIV co-infection among IDUs were sparse. This study aimed to identify risk factors of HCV/HIV co-infection and HCV mono-infection, as compared with seronegativity, among injecting drug users (IDUs) at a large methadone maintenance treatment program (MMTP) in Taipei, Taiwan. METHODS Data from enrollment interviews and HCV and HIV testing completed by IDUs upon admission to the Taipei City Hospital MMTP from 2006-2010 were included in this cross-sectional analysis. HCV and HIV testing was repeated among re-enrollees whose HCV or HIV test results were negative at the preceding enrollment. Backward stepwise multinomial logistic regression was used to identify risk factors associated with HCV/HIV co-infection and HCV mono-infection. RESULTS Of the 1,447 IDUs enrolled, the prevalences of HCV/HIV co-infection, HCV mono-infection, and HIV mono-infection were 13.1%, 78.0%, and 0.4%, respectively. In backward stepwise multinomial regression analysis, after controlling for potential confounders, syringe sharing in the 6 months before MMTP enrollment was significantly positively associated with HCV/HIV co-infection (adjusted odds ratio [AOR]=27.72, 95% confidence interval [CI] 13.30-57.76). Incarceration was also significantly positively associated with HCV/HIV co-infection (AOR=2.01, 95% CI 1.71-2.37) and HCV mono-infection (AOR=1.77, 95% CI 1.52-2.06), whereas smoking amphetamine in the 6 months before MMTP enrollment was significantly inversely associated with HCV/HIV co-infection (AOR=0.44, 95% CI 0.25-0.76) and HCV mono-infection (AOR=0.49, 95% CI 0.32-0.75). HCV seroincidence was 45.25/100 person-years at risk (PYAR; 95% CI 24.74-75.92/100 PYAR) and HIV seroincidence was 0.53/100 PYAR (95% CI 0.06-1.91/100 PYAR) among re-enrolled IDUs who were HCV- or HIV-negative at the preceding enrollment. CONCLUSIONS IDUs enrolled in Taipei MMTPs had very high prevalences of HCV/HIV co-infection and HCV mono-infection. Interventions such as expansion of syringe exchange programs and education regarding HCV/HIV prevention should be implemented for this high-risk group of drug users.

Abstract
Preventing the onset of injection drug use is important in controlling the spread of HIV and other blood borne infections. Undocumented migrants in the United States face social, economic, and legal stressors that may contribute to substance abuse. Little is known about undocumented migrants' drug abuse trajectories including injection initiation. To examine the correlates and contexts of US injection initiation among undocumented migrants, we administered quantitative surveys (N = 309) and qualitative interviews (N = 23) on migration and drug abuse experiences to deported male injection drug users in Tijuana, Mexico. US injection initiation was independently associated with ever using drugs in Mexico pre-migration, younger age at first US migration, and US incarceration. Participants' qualitative interviews contextualized quantitative findings and demonstrated the significance of social contexts surrounding US injection initiation experiences. HIV prevention programs may prevent/delay US injection initiation by addressing socio-economic and migration-related stressors experienced by undocumented migrants.

Abstract
One consequence of the global HIV/AIDS pandemic has been the emergence of a broad awareness of the potential role of syringes in the transmission of infectious diseases. In addition to HIV/AIDS, the use of unsterile syringes by multiple persons has been linked to the spread of Hepatitis B, Hepatitis C, Leishmaniasis, malaria and various other infections. The purpose of this paper is to extend awareness of the grave risks of multiperson syringe use by examining the role of this behavior in the development of infectious disease syndemics. The term syndemics refers to the clustering, often due to noxious social conditions, of two or more diseases in a population resulting in adverse disease synergies that impact human life and well-being. The contemporary appearance and spread of identified syringe-mediated syndemics, and the potential for the emergence of future syringe-mediated syndemics, both of which are reviewed in this paper, underline the importance of public health measures designed to limit syringe-related disease transmission.

Abstract
BACKGROUND Isolated antibody to hepatitis B core antigen (anti-HBc) is defined as seropositivity for anti-HBc in the absence of hepatitis B surface antigen (HBsAg) and antibody to HBsAg (anti-HBs). It is commonly found in HIV-infected persons or hepatitis C virus (HCV)-infected persons, but the risk factors for isolated anti-HBc remain uncertain, especially in regions that are hyperendemic for hepatitis B virus (HBV) infection. METHODS This cross-sectional study included a cohort of 955 nonhemophiliac, HIV-infected patients, diagnosed between 1988 and 2009, and 643 HIV-uninfected injection drug users (IDUs) attending the methadone clinic between August 2007 and May 2009, with available HBV serological data. The medical records were reviewed to identify the risk factors associated with seropositivity of isolated anti-HBc. RESULTS The overall seroprevalence of isolated anti-HBc was 12.1% (193 of 1598), in which occult HBV infection accounted for 1.6% (3 of 185) and the majority (91.2 %, 176 of 193) had low titers of anti-HBs (3.6 +/- 2.9 IU/L). Subjects with isolated anti-HBc were significantly older (40.7 +/- 9.3 versus 36.9 +/- 8.0, respectively, P < 0.0001). There was a significantly increasing trend in the prevalence of isolated anti-HBc with age, from 4.0% in those younger than 30 years to 22.5% after 50 years of age (test for trend, P < 0.0001). A significantly higher prevalence of isolated anti-HBc was observed in HIV-infected subjects [14.0% (134 of 955) versus 9.2% (59 of 643), adjusted odds ratio, 1.64; P < 0.01], but not in those with HCV infection (P = 0.18). CONCLUSIONS Isolated anti-HBc seropositivity was significantly associated with HIV infection, and older age. HCV infection was not associated with isolated anti-HBc in a country hyperendemic with HBV infection, even in populations with a high prevalence of HCV infection. The majority was not attributable to occult HBV infection, but rather, low level of anti-HBs, suggesting that HBV vaccination may not be required.

Abstract
INTRODUCTION AND AIMS The prevalence of hepatitis C virus (HCV) among heroin dependants in treatment was estimated at 89.9%; however, virtually no information exists on the prevalence or risk behaviour among the larger population of drug users not in treatment. This study assessed the prevalence of HCV and associated risk factors among this group with a view to designing more effective intervention programs. DESIGN AND METHODS A cross-sectional survey of 552 not-in-treatment drug users recruited from five key urban centres across peninsular Malaysia with on-site serological testing for HCV and HIV seropositivity was conducted. RESULTS HCV prevalence was 65.4% for the overall sample, but higher among injecting drug users (67.1%) relative to non-injecting drug users (30.8%). Bivariate analysis suggested seven risk factors though only sharing injecting paraphernalia and lifetime homosexual/bisexual behaviour remained significant in multivariate analysis. DISCUSSION AND CONCLUSIONS With the majority (65.9%) sharing injecting equipment and about the same proportion (65.4%) being HCV positive, the risk of further transmission to new drug users is high. It is imperative that the nascent needle and syringe exchange and condom distribution program and its ancillary services--launched in 2005 to fight HIV--be fine tuned, as a first step, to control HCV. With its greater infectivity and non-symptomatic character, HCV is more insidious. Given the shared risk factors of HCV and HIV, routine screening of drug users for HCV--currently non-existent--should be instituted. This, with other intervention measures, will help detect and control HCV at an earlier stage while also checking the spread of HIV.

Abstract
The authors examined the relation between time since onset of illicit drug injection (time at risk) and rates of hepatitis C virus (HCV) infection by using meta-regression. In 72 prevalence studies, median time since onset of injection was 7.24 years and median prevalence was 66.02%. The model showed statistically significant linear and quadratic effects of time at risk on HCV prevalence and significantly higher prevalence in developing and transitional countries and in earlier samples (1985-1995). In developed countries post-1995, mean fitted prevalence was 32.02% (95% confidence interval: 25.31, 39.58) at 1 year of injection and 53.01% (95% confidence interval: 40.69, 65.09) at 5 years. In developing/transitional countries post-1995, mean fitted HCV prevalence was 59.13% (95% confidence interval: 30.39, 82.74) at 1 year of injection. In 10 incidence studies, median time at risk was 5.29 years and median cumulative HCV incidence was 20.69%. Mean fitted cumulative incidence was 27.63% (95% confidence interval: 16.92, 41.70) at 1 year of drug injection. The authors concluded that time to HCV infection in developed countries has lengthened. More rapid onset of HCV infection in drug injectors in developing/transitional countries resembles an earlier era of the HCV epidemic in other regions.

Abstract
BACKGROUND/PURPOSE The purpose of this study was to compare the seroprevalence of viral hepatitis and sexually transmitted disease (STD) co-infections among three populations at risk recently diagnosed with HIV infection. METHODS A retrospective review of medical records was performed to determine the prevalence of several co-infections among adults recently diagnosed with HIV infection between 2000 and 2005 at National Cheng Kung University Hospital in Tainan, Taiwan. RESULTS Among a total of 484 adults, 124 (25.6%) were men having sex with men (MSM), 105 (21.7%) were heterosexual adults, and 255 (52.7%) were injection drug users (IDUs). The case number of adults with recently diagnosed HIV infection increased annually, from 27 in 2000 to 142 in 2005 (p < 0.001). This trend appeared to be attributable to the upsurge in HIV infection among IDUs beginning in 2003. At the time of HIV diagnosis, mean CD4+ counts were significantly higher and plasma HIV-1 RNA loads were lower in the IDU group than the MSM or heterosexual groups. The hepatitis B virus (HBV) carrier rate was similar in all three groups, with an average rate of 16.5%. The prevalence of treponemal antibody and Entamoeba histolytica indirect hemagglutination antibody was higher in MSM (37.5% and 9.4%, respectively) than in heterosexuals (19.6% and 7.3%, respectively) or IDUs (3.2% and 2.1%). The seroprevalence of hepatitis A virus infection increased with age, with 94.2% (97/103) of patients who were older than 40 years. Hepatitis C virus (HCV) or HBV-HCV co-infections were noted more often in IDUs (97.9% and 16.9%, respectively) than in heterosexuals (10.9% and 2.2%, respectively) and MSM (5.3% and 3.6%, respectively). CONCLUSION There was a recent upsurge in HIV-HCV co-infected IDUs in southern Taiwan. A higher rate of co-infection with STDs among HIV-infected MSM highlights the need for integrated STD control efforts in current HIV prevention programs.

Abstract
We employed recently developed statistical methods to explore the epidemic behaviour of hepatitis C subtype 1a and subtype 3a among injecting drug users (IDUs) in Flanders, Belgium, using new gene sequence data sampled among two geographically distinct populations of IDUs. First the extent of hepatitis C transmission across regions/countries was studied through calculation of association indices. It was shown that viral exchange had occurred between both populations in Flanders as well as across international borders. Furthermore, evidence was found suggestive of subtypes 1a and 3a predominantly circulating in subpopulations of Flemish IDUs, exhibiting different degrees of travelling/migration behaviour. Secondly, through coalescent-based analysis the viral epidemic history of the hepatitis C subtype 1a and 3a epidemics was inferred. Evidence was found for different dynamic forces driving both epidemics. Moreover, results suggested that the hepatitis C subtype 3a epidemic has reached a steady state, while the hepatitis C 1a epidemic has not, which therefore might become the predominant subtype among IDUs.

Abstract
BACKGROUND/PURPOSE Injection drug users (IDUs) have become the major contributors to the human immunodeficiency virus (HIV)/acquired immunodeficiency syndrome epidemic in Taiwan, accounting for more than 60% of new cases in 2005. In Taiwan, gender difference in risk factors for HIV among IDUs has not been reported before. We studied the clinical and sociodemographic characteristics, sexual behaviors, drug use histories and criminal records of male and female HIV-infected IDUs. METHODS A total of 100 male and 25 female HIV-infected inmates from two prisons were included. An individually structured interview was conducted with each inmate. Serostatus of hepatitis B virus (HBV) and hepatitis C virus (HCV) were tested. CD4+ T cell count and HIV viral load were also evaluated. RESULTS The mean age of the HIV-infected inmates was 31.7 +/- 6.4 years. All inmates were co-infected with HCV and 20% were HBV carriers. The mean CD4+ T cell count was 498 cells/microL, and the mean viral load was 20,119 copies/mL. Heroin use history averaged 6.3 +/- 5.1 years, and 84.8% of patients had a previous criminal offense prior to current conviction. Female inmates were significantly younger, had more sexual partners, had more drug-using family members or sexual partners, shared injection paraphernalia more frequently, and started using methamphetamine and heroin at younger ages (p < 0.05). Male inmates tended to be single, had less parental support, had been more frequently convicted of non drug-related crimes, started using non-illicit substances more frequently at younger ages and had sex with prostitutes more frequently (p < 0.05). CONCLUSION The results of this study suggest that drug injection risks and sexual behavior related risks are equally important in determining the risk of HIV infection among IDUs. Gender-specific approaches to prevention which reflect differences in gender-related patterns of risk are also needed.

Abstract
This systematic review examined the evidence on the prevalence of the Hepatitis C Virus (HCV) in non-injecting drug users (NIDUs) who sniff, smoke or snort drugs such as heroin, cocaine, crack or methamphetamine. The search included studies published from January 1989 to January 2006. Twenty-eight eligible studies were identified and the prevalence of HCV in these NIDU populations ranged from 2.3 to 35.3%. There was substantial variation in study focus and in the quality of the NIDU data presented in the studies. The results of our systematic review suggested that there are important gaps in the research of HCV in NIDUs. We identified a problem of study focus; much of the research did not aim to study HCV in users of non-injection drugs. Instead, NIDUs were typically included as a secondary research concern, with a principal focus on the problem of transmission of HCV in IDU populations. Despite methodological issues, HCV prevalence in this population is much higher than in a non-drug using population, even though some IDUs might have inadvertently been included in the NIDU samples. These studies point to a real problem of HCV in NIDU populations, but the causal pathway to infection remains unclear.

Abstract
In industrialized countries, transmission of hepatitis C occurs primarily through injecting drug use. Transmission of hepatitis C in injecting drug users is mainly associated with the sharing of contaminated syringes/needles, although evidence for risk of hepatitis C infection through sharing of other injecting paraphernalia is increasing. In this paper, the independent effects of sharing paraphernalia other than syringes/needles have been estimated. The prevalence and force of infection were modelled using three serological data sets from drug users in three centres in Belgium as a function of the sharing behaviour. It was found that sharing of materials other than syringes/needles indeed seemed to contribute substantially to the spread of hepatitis C among injecting drug users.

Abstract
Since its discovery in 1989, hepatitis C virus (HCV) has become a major public health problem. HCV chronically infects an estimated 170 million people worldwide. The seroprevalence of anti-HCV antibody in the United States has been estimated at 1.8%, which corresponds to approximately 4 million people. HCV is the most common chronic blood borne infection in the United States, and the leading cause of liver transplantation in developed countries. Injection drug use is the dominant mode of HCV transmission and accounts for up to 90% of current infections. Opiates and other drug abuse, such as alcohol, have been implicated as cofactors in the pathogenesis of HCV disease. Injection drug use has been the most common risk factor identified in alcoholics with HCV infection. Both opiates and alcohol contribute significantly to morbidity and mortality from HCV disease. These drugs most likely act synergistically to promote the development and progression of HCV disease. However, there is limited information available concerning the interaction of the drug abuse with the host cell innate immunity against HCV infection, which is a major barrier to fundamental understanding of the immunopathogenesis of HCV disease. Therefore, defining the role of the drug abuse in the development of chronic HCV infection is of crucial importance and should provide practical guidance toward the reduction of risk factors that interfere with therapeutic approaches for HCV infection and disease. This review paper focuses on the interplay between drug abuse (opiates and alcohol), innate immunity and HCV in the context of the development of HCV disease.

Abstract
BACKGROUND Growing awareness about the importance of blood safety for controlling the transmission of hepatitis C virus (HCV) has helped to decrease the spread of this virus in many settings. This study was conducted in order to evaluate potential risk factors for HCV infection among blood donors in Georgia. METHODS The study population consisted of 553 blood donors in three major Georgian cities: Tbilisi, the capital city and Batumi and Poti, naval port cities. Risk factors were examined using a behavior questionnaire. All blood samples were initially tested using 3rd generation anti-HCV enzyme-linked immunosorbent assays and confirmed using recombinant immunoblot assays and nucleic acid testing. RESULTS Forty-three blood donors, 7.8%, were confirmed HCV positive. Significant risk factors included: drug injection ever (OR: 42; 95% CI: 3.2-550.7); history of hepatitis (OR: 25.9; 95% CI: 4.6-145.5); history of a previous surgical procedure (OR: 148.4; 95% CI: 26.9-817.4); blood transfusion (OR: 25.9; 95% CI: 3.2-210.9). CONCLUSIONS This study found a very high prevalence of HCV among blood donors in Georgia. The main risk factor for HCV infection in this population of blood donors was previous contact with contaminated blood or blood products. Reliable screening of donors and their blood is critical for controlling the further spread of HCV in Georgia.

Abstract
Hepatitis C virus (HCV) burdens injection drug users (IDUs) with prevalence estimated from 60-100% compared to around 5% among noninjection drug users (non-IDUs). We present preliminary data comparing the risk for HCV among IDUs and non-IDUs to inform new avenues of HCV prevention and intervention planning. Two cohorts, new IDUs (injecting < or =3 years) and non-IDUs (smoke/sniff heroine, crack or cocaine < or =10 years), ages 15-40, were street-recruited in New York City. Participants underwent risk surveys and HCV serology at baseline and 6-month follow-up visits. Person-time analysis was used to estimate annual HCV incidence. Of 683 non-IDUs, 653 were HCV seronegative, 422 returned for at least 1 follow-up visit, and 1 became HCV seropositive. Non-IDUs contributed 246.3 person-years (PY) yielding an annual incident rate of 0.4/100 PY (95% Confidence Interval [CI]=0.0-1.2). Of 260 IDUs, 114 were HCV seronegative, 62 returned for at least 1 follow-up visit, and 13 became HCV seropositive. IDUs contributed 36.3 PY yielding an annual incidence rate of 35.9/100 PY (95%CI=19.1-61.2). Among IDUs, HCV seroconverters tended to be younger (median age 25 vs. 28, respectively), and inject more frequently (61.5% vs. 34.7%, respectively) than non-seroconverters. These interim data suggest that IDUs may have engaged in high-risk practices prior to being identified for prevention services. Preventing or at least delaying transition into injection could increase opportunity to intervene. Identifying risk factors for transition into injection could inform early prevention to reduce onset of injection and risk of HCV.

Abstract
Current approaches to prevention of blood-borne infections in injection drug users include referral to drug abuse treatment, access to sterile syringes, bleach disinfection of injection equipment, and education about not sharing equipment. However, rates of some blood-borne infections (e.g., hepatitis C virus) remain elevated among injection drug users, especially early after initiation into injection drug use. With lower infection rates in noninjectors and transition into injection drug use occurring most commonly among these noninjectors, prevention of transition into injection drug use as an additional step to reduce risk for acquisition and transmission of blood-borne infections merits closer attention.

Abstract
Little information is available regarding whether substance abuse enhances hepatitis C virus (HCV) replication and promotes HCV disease progression. We investigated whether morphine alters HCV mRNA expression in HCV replicon-containing liver cells. Morphine significantly increased HCV mRNA expression, an effect which could be abolished by either of the opioid receptor antagonists, naltrexone or beta-funaltrexamine. Investigation of the mechanism responsible for this enhancement of HCV replicon expression demonstrated that morphine activated NF-kappaB promoter and that caffeic acid phenethyl ester, a specific inhibitor of the activation of NF-kappaB, blocked morphine-activated HCV RNA expression. In addition, morphine compromised the anti-HCV effect of interferon alpha (IFN-alpha). Our in vitro data indicate that morphine may play an important role as a positive regulator of HCV replication in human hepatic cells and may compromise IFN-alpha therapy.

Abstract
OBJECTIVES To investigate hepatitis C (HCV) and human immunodeficiency virus (HIV-1) prevalence in former opiate or heroin addicts currently in methadone maintenance treatment (MMT). METHODS Retrospective chart review for patients (n = 342) currently attending two MMT clinics affiliated with New York Presbyterian Hospital (Adolescent Development Program, ADP: n = 106, median age 30 years; Adult Clinic, AC: n = 236, median age 45 years), as of May 2000. RESULTS Overall seroprevalence of those tested was 67% for HCV (ADP, 44%; AC, 80%), and 29% for HIV-1 (ADP, 13%, AC, 39%). Co-infection was present in 26% of patients (ADP, 13%; AC, 35%). Prevalence of HCV reached 92% in the 45-49 year old group (n = 53). The greatest HIV-1 prevalence (45%) was in the 35-39 year old group (n = 33). There was a linear relationship between infection seroprevalence and age at admission into MMT. CONCLUSIONS The high prevalence of HCV and HIV-1 infections in MMT patients varies both by current age and by age at admission to MMT. This population needs risk reduction education and treatment for HCV and HIV- 1.

Abstract
The aim of the study was to analyse the current literature regarding the mode of transmission of HCV and its global prevalence in different groups of people. A systematic review of the literature on the epidemiology of hepatitis C from 1991 to 2000 using computerized bibliographic databases which include Medline, Current Content and Embase. The prevalence of hepatitis C virus (HCV) varies tremendously in different parts of the world, with the highest incidence in the Eastern parts of the globe compared with the Western parts. Furthermore, certain groups of individuals such as intravenous drug users are at increased risk of acquiring this disease irrespective of the geographical location. Although the main route of transmission is via contaminated blood, curiously enough in up to 50% of the cases no recognizable transmission factor/route could be identified. Therefore, a number of other routes of transmission such as sexual or household exposure to infected contacts have been investigated with conflicting results. Hepatitis C infection is an important public health issue globally. Better understanding of routes of transmission will help to combat the spread of disease. In order to prevent a world wide epidemic of this disease, urgent measures are required to (i) develop a strategy to inform and educate the public regarding this disease and (ii) expedite the efforts to develop a vaccine.
